Configure Amazon Chime
- DarkLight
Note:
This is applicable only for Tethered model.
This section defines the configuration for Amazon Chime Voice. To use Chime Voice connector for Nailed call connection to Agent, you must create Amazon Chime Voice Connector service in same region where Amazon Connect instance is running.
Perform the following steps:
Login to AWS Console where Amazon Connect Instance is available.
Go to Amazon Chime SDK Service.
Go to Voice Connector and click Create new voice connector.
Enter a Voice Connector Name.
Select a region from the AWS region dropdown.
Select the Encryption as Enabled.
Click Create. Open the newly created Connector.
From the General tab, share the Voice Connector ID to the Campaign Manager Team.
In the Termination tab, select the Enabled for Termination status and share the Outbound host name to the Campaign Manager team.
In the Allowed hosts list tab, add two IPs of the Amazon Connect stack provided by Campaign Manager.
Example, 55.203.60.23/32. The default value for Calls per second is 1 and leave it as is. To increase this, contact AWS Support.
In the Calling Plan field, select the countries required for outbound dialing. For example, United States of America, Canada.
In the Credentials section, click Create.
Create a New User and share the details to the Campaign Manager Team.
In the CallerID override section, map the Amazon Chime phone number. To procure a phone number, refer to https://docs.aws.amazon.com/chime/latest/ag/provision-phone.html.
To port the phone number into Amazon Chime, refer to porting.html.
Click Save.
Disable the status in the Origination tab.
Go to the Phone number tab.
Map the procured phone number in this tab.
Go to the Logging tab.
Activate SIP message and Media metric logs.
Go to click Voice connectors and click Global Settings.
Click Call detail records. For Voice Connector Configuration, select any S3 bucket name that is not encrypted with custom KMS Key. For more information on managing Amazon Chime configuration, refer to voice-connectors.html.
